Published date:09/05/2026 | Last updated date:09/05/2026 Researchers in China have developed a deep learning method that can rapidly generate optimized continuous fiber-reinforced composite structures, potentially reducing one of the biggest bottlenecks in advanced composite design. The study, published in Acta Mechanica Sinica, introduces a ResUNet-GAN framework that predicts both structural topology and continuous fiber orientation […]
